Town upgrades in Octopath Traveler 0 come in the form of key items you obtain from certain characters you interact with. The main upgrades you can find by talking to characters in the game are House and Establishment Blueprints, Recipe Books, List of Trade Goods, Equipment Archive, Additional Smithy Recipe, and Seeds.

While House and Establishment Blueprints unlock new styles for the buildings in town, Recipe Books will increase the variety of meals you can cook by using the hub. Lists of Trade Goods, Equipment Archives, and Additional Smithy Recipe affect the store, which begins to sell items from other regions and regularly receives batches of special items like seeds and animals. Seeds are used in your farm.

To obtain the upgrades, you must find the right character to use one of the Path Actions (Inquire, Purchase, or Contend) on to receive the key item that automatically upgrades one of the services available in town. You may get “Collection Point Info” from a few of them when using “Inquire.” This means the item will appear somewhere on the map (marked by an exclamation sign) for you to collect. In our experience, “Roberta of Rapture” in Donescu is the only character who requires you to use the “Contend” Path Action instead of the “Inquire” to earn her Recipe Book. There’s also a chance of finding these upgrades being sold in Wishvale’s store.

Be sure to interact with all the characters listed here as soon as you can, since there’s a point in the campaign where some locations are affected by the main events and some NPCs won’t be present anymore.
